Bibby Philosophy

Grow sceptics, not cynics

Bibby Philosophy treats doubt as a disciplined invitation to inspect a claim, not as a reason to abandon judgment.

Language, reasoning, imagination, open-mindedness and self-reflection recur across the curriculum so that progress remains recognisably philosophical.
